Q: Is 6,195,345 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 6,195,345 is a composite number.

Why is 6,195,345 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 6,195,345 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 13 15 39 65 195 31,771 95,313 158,855 413,023 476,565 1,239,069 2,065,115 and 6,195,345, with no remainder.

Since 6,195,345 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,195,345, it is a composite number.
